Julia and Sam’s wedding day was nothing short of the perfect Southern, summer wedding. We are so thankful that they asked us to help document such an amazing day spent celebrating their love.

“Julia and I are always surrounded by friends. The friend group she introduced me to really accepted me and are some of my closest friends. We love being with them. One place that was kind of just ours, was the roof top of my condo downtown. We would share a meal or a bottle of wine up there and enjoy sunsets from time to time. I set the stage, with the help of her friends, with candles, white table cloth, and champagne and asked her to meet me up there before going out with friends. Julia was completely surprised when she opened the door & we shared a beautiful moment up there with the sun setting over the river.” -Sam 

“I was so nervous during the wedding preparation with the anticipation of how the day would play out. We decided to do a first look and the moment I saw Sam all of my worries went away. I was able to relax and be in the moment without worrying about the small stuff.” -Julia

“For us, the most special thing was being surrounded by the people that are closest to us. It’s really the only time that everyone that helped mold you into the person you are is in one place. Through life you create different friend groups and seeing those worlds collide along with family was special. Seeing family, childhood friends, high school friends, college friends, and post college friends interact and get along is something I’ve always looked forward to. Each one of them played a role in developing us and molding us into the people that we are as individuals and what made us so compatible as a couple.” -Sam

“Sam and I are both University of Tennessee fans. I went to UT and Sam went to West Alabama to play baseball but grew up a huge UT fan. We brought out UT shakers for Rocky Top. It was fun to incorporate into the wedding.” -Julia 

“We had the best vendors! Al Paris killed it and we felt like we were at a concert. He made it so fun for everyone. He and the band brought a ton of energy and the dance floor was full of people the entire time.” -Julia

“My advice to future brides would be to not sweat the small stuff, try to be in the moment, and take it all in. Things will go wrong and did go wrong but I was only worried about being with Sam and trying to soak up every second.” -Julia
